Форматировщик кода

Немедленно форматируйте и форматируйте код на нескольких языках с помощью этого бесплатного онлайн-форматировщика кода. Поддерживает JavaScript, HTML, CSS и многое другое, без необходимости входа в систему.
Строка 1, Столбец 1

О приложении

Поддержка нескольких языков

Институциональный формат кода в JavaScript, TypeScript, HTML, CSS, JSON и большем.

Форматирование в реальном времени

Немедленно отформатируйте код одним щелчком кнопки «Форматировать».

Выделение синтаксиса

Просматривайте код с правильным выделением синтаксиса для лучшей читабельности.

Функция копирования

Легко копируйте отформатированный код в буфер обмена с помощью кнопки «Копировать».

Отслеживание позиции курсора

Отслеживайте текущую строку и столбец в текстовом редакторе.

Справка

Форматирование кода - это процесс переустройства исходного кода для улучшения его читабельности и поддерживаемости без изменения его функциональности. Это включает в себя применение согласованных правил для отступа, интервалов, переносов строк и других стилистических элементов. Правильное форматирование повышает понимание кода, снижает ошибки и упрощает совместную работу разработчиков. Многие языки программирования имеют установленные руководства по стилю, такие как PEP 8 для Python или Google JavaScript Style Guide, которые предоставляют стандартизированные правила форматирования.

Расчет

Форматировщик кода использует библиотеку Prettier для разбора и переформатирования входного кода. Prettier создаёт дерево абстрактной синтаксической конструкции (AST) из входных данных, а затем переходит по этому дереву, чтобы сгенерировать однородно отформатированную выходную информацию. Он применяет языковые правила для элементов, таких как отступ, перевод на новую строку и интервалы. Форматировщик также принимает во внимание такие факторы, как максимальная длина строки и предпочтительный стиль кавычек. Хотя точные алгоритмы различаются в зависимости от языка, Prettier стремится производить детерминированный вывод, то есть одно и то же входное значение всегда будет приводить к одному и тому же отформатированному коду.

Часто задаваемые вопросы

Какие языки поддерживаются этим Форматировщиком кода?
Приложение поддерживает форматирование для JavaScript, TypeScript, Flow, JSX, JSON, CSS, SCSS, Less, HTML, Vue, Angular, GraphQL, Markdown и YAML.
Как форматирование кода повышает качество разработки?
Согласованное форматирование делает код более легким для чтения, понимания и сопровождения, следуя стандартным конвенциям и стилям.
Хранится ли введённый мной код где-либо или передаётся?
Нет, все форматирование происходит локально в вашем браузере. Ваш код никогда не передаётся и не хранится на каких-либо внешних серверах.
Могу ли я настроить правила форматирования?
Приложение использует параметры по умолчанию Prettier, которые основаны на общих предпочтениях сообщества. Настройка не поддерживается.
Как использовать отформатированный код в моём проекте?
После форматирования вы можете использовать кнопку «Копировать», чтобы скопировать отформатированный код и вставить его в свою среду разработки.